What is an MVP? :

The concept of a Minimum Viable Product (MVP) originated from the Lean Startup success methodology developed by Eric Ries. It refers to the creation of a simplified version of your product or service that showcases its core functionality. The primary goal of an MVP is to gather feedback from early adopters, learn from their experiences, and iterate on the product based on their valuable insights.

Advantage of MVP for Startup :

1. Faster Time to Market :

By focusing on developing the essential features of your product or service, you can significantly reduce the time required for development and launch. This enables you to enter the market quickly and start gathering real-world feedback.

2. Cost-Effective :

Developing a full-featured product can be a costly endeavor, especially for startups with limited resources. By prioritizing the key functionalities and launching an MVP, you can save costs and allocate your resources more efficiently.

3. Validating Assumptions :

An MVP allows you to test your assumptions and hypotheses in the real market. By gathering feedback from early adopters, you can validate your value proposition, identify potential flaws, and make informed decisions for future iterations.

4. Attracting Investors :

Investors are more likely to be interested in startups that have already demonstrated traction and validated their ideas through an MVP. By showcasing a working prototype and positive user feedback, you increase your chances of securing funding for further development.

5. Risk reduction :

By focusing on the essential features, the MVP approach minimizes the risk of developing a product that does not resonate with the target audience. It allows businesses to test their hypotheses and gathers data-driven insights early on, which can guide future development efforts and minimize the risk of building a product that fails in the market.

6. Iterative improvement :

The MVP approach is inherently iterative, allowing for incremental enhancements based on user feedback and market insights. This iterative development cycle ensures that the product evolves over time, addressing user needs, incorporating new features, and adapting to changing market conditions. This agile approach enables businesses to stay ahead of the competition and deliver a product that continuously adds value to users.

7. Focus on core value proposition :

By prioritizing the most critical features, the MVP approach helps businesses to define and deliver the core value proposition of their product. This ensures that the initial release provides a compelling user experience and solves a specific problem effectively. It prevents feature bloat and helps maintain a clear focus on delivering value to the target audience.

FAQ’s

1. How many iterations should I aim for with my MVP?

It depends on the complexity of your product and the feedback you receive. Aim for a minimum of three iterations to gather sufficient data and make meaningful improvements. However, the number of iterations may vary based on your specific circumstances.

2. Can I launch an MVP for a service-based startup?

Absolutely! The MVP approach is not limited to product-based startups. You can apply the same principles to service-based startups by focusing on delivering the core value of your service in a simplified form.

3. How do I effectively manage feedback from early adopters?

To manage feedback effectively, establish a system for organizing and categorizing feedback. Prioritize the issues based on their impact and frequency. Regularly communicate with your early adopters to keep them updated on the progress and changes based on their feedback.
